2021-22 Women's Tennis Roster

Kacey Moore

  • Class Senior
  • Height 5-6
  • High School Wellington
  • Hometown Wellington, Fla.

Biography

Accolades Won
• 2022 Patriot League Academic Honor Roll
• 2022 All-Patriot League Second Team
• 2021 All-Patriot League First Team

2021-22 - Senior: Named Second Team All-Patriot League … Finished the season tied for the second-most singles victories on the team at 22 … Went 14-5 in dual competition and 4-1 against Patriot League opponents … Recorded 22 wins on the doubles circuit that a perfect 4-0 record in Patriot League contests …  44 combined wins between doubles and singles ranks tied for the fourth most in a single season by a Navy women’s tennis player … Finishes career with the fourth-most singles victories in program history (70) and the ninth-highest singles win percentage (.700) … 120 combined career victories rank as the sixth most in team history … Won the doubles “B” flight at the Bill & Sandra Moore Invitational … Won the singles “B” flight at the Navy Blue & Gold Invitational … Secured the match-clinching point in a 4-1 victory over Army in the Star Match … Named team’s Unsung Hero ... Named to the Patriot League Academic Honor Roll.

2020-21 - Junior: Named First Team All-Patriot League … Over the top two singles positions in the Navy lineup, Moore finished with a record of 5-4 overall … She finished with a 4-3 record at No. 2 singles and a 1-1 mark at No. 1 singles … Moore completed Navy’s comeback win over Army in the Patriot League Semifinals where she came from behind to win at No. 2 singles (3-6, 6-2, 6-2) … Moore also posted a 4-2 record in doubles while going 3-1 in Patriot League matches … She finished with a 3-2 mark at No. 3 doubles while going 1-0 in her lone appearance at the second-seeded flight … Named the team’s Most Valuable Player

2019-20 - Sophomore: Moore finished third on the team with 16 singles wins en route to a 16-12 record for the season … Moore also posted a 12-5 mark in doubles matches to go along with a 5-1 record in the spring … Moore partnered with Danika Kahatapitiya to win the doubles “B” flight at the Navy Blue & Gold Invitational … She also finished fourth overall in the singles “A” flight at the Navy Blue & Gold Invitational … Named team's Most Improved Player

2018-19 - Freshman: Moore recorded the second-most singles wins in program history for a single season with 27 and her record of 27-3 is the best winning percentage for a single season in program history for singles matches at .900 … Moore went 18-2 in dual matches including a 7-0 mark at No. 6 singles … In doubles, Moore went 12-3 overall and 6-2 in dual competition playing at each of the three doubles spots … Moore won singles “C” flight at the Bill and Sandra Moore Invitational and competed in the semifinals of all three singles tournament she took part in during the fall … She finished as the runner up in the doubles “B” flight at the Bill and Sandra Moore Invitational with Annalise Klopfer and competed in the final at the Stony Brook Invitational with Klopfer

Personal: During her high school career, she attended American Heritage High School and then Wellington High School … She is ranked 125th in the TennisRecuriting.net rankings and listed as a four-star recruit … She competed at the No. 3 and No. 4 spots for American Heritage and then moved up to the No. 1 spot at Wellington … Won the 2014 Florida State Singles Championship, and then won the 2015 Florida State Singles and Doubles Championships … Was an All-County First Team performer in 2015 and then was selected as a 2018 National High School All-American … Attended the Naval Academy Preparatory School … Daughter of Tristram Moore and Darleen Moore … Named to Naval Academy's Commandant's List twice and Dean's List once.
